Distribution of the species in Genisto-Quercetum petreae according to flora elements, and diversity and evenness values of them Eurasian (-Mediterranean) 9 Central-European 8 Eurasian 7 European (-Mediterranean) 6 European 4 Central-European (-Mediterranean) 3 Central-European (-Submediterranean) 2 Circumpolar 2 Circumpolar-Cosmopolitan 1 Circumpolar-Mediterranean 1 Eurosiberian 2 Eurasian-Eurosiberlan 1 European (-Submediterranean) 1 European-Eurasian 1 Subatlantic-Central-European 1 Pannon-Balk an 1 Amphiatlantic 1 N = 51; S = 17; H' d = 3.59; Lj = 0.88 Where N = number of species; (n = number of species belonging to same type of flora ele­ments); S = number of species distribution area. According to distribution area of species (Table 4) there are several frequent species the Eurasian-Mediterranean, Central-European-Mediterran­ean,, Eurasian, European-Mediterranean and the European ones.
